      Hey guys,

      The esteemed faculty here at SVS have a new series that we are launching that is a little more informal and shows how we work. No real instruction is intended per se, but as a student I always loved seeing how people worked. So we thought we would share our process too. And that includes basic sketches all the way to finished sketches and paintings. We don't have an official place for these videos yet, so I thought I post it here for you guys first.

      I'm working on a book and am doing black and white comps for the client. They have changed the layout of the book and some other perameters. All week I am going to be doing these fast changes for them. The total working time on this painting is 1 hour and shows sort of how I go about it. Nothing fancy for sure. I have to do 16 of these in 4 days, so speed is sort of essential.

      Some things to notice:

      • Lay in is simple solid shapes
      • Then cleaned up a little with my clumsy drawing style
      • I don't use lighting anymore, but it would have been added 3rd if I did.
      • I use custom brushes that are explained in my photoshop brush making video
